centOS如何查看并放行防火墙3306端口

在CentOS系统中,您可以使用firewall-cmd命令来检查防火墙规则,确认是否放行了3306端口。以下是步骤和示例代码:

  1. 首先,确保您的系统上安装了firewalld服务。如果未安装,请使用以下命令安装:

sudo yum install firewalld

  1. 启动并启用firewalld服务:

sudo systemctl start firewalld

sudo systemctl enable firewalld

  1. 检查3306端口是否已经被放行:

sudo firewall-cmd --list-ports

如果输出中包含3306/tcp,则表示3306端口已经被放行。

  1. 如果3306端口没有在防火墙规则中,您可以使用以下命令添加:

sudo firewall-cmd --zone=public --add-port=3306/tcp --permanent

  1. 重新加载防火墙以应用更改:

sudo firewall-cmd --reload

现在,您已经确认了防火墙是否放行了3306端口

相关推荐
Sheffield15 小时前
Docker的跨主机服务与其对应的优缺点
linux·网络协议·docker
Sheffield1 天前
Alpine是什么,为什么是Docker首选?
linux·docker·容器
0xDevNull2 天前
MySQL索引进阶用法
后端·mysql
舒一笑2 天前
程序员效率神器:一文掌握 tmux(服务器开发必备工具)
运维·后端·程序员
0xDevNull2 天前
MySQL索引用法
mysql
Johny_Zhao2 天前
centos7安装部署openclaw
linux·人工智能·信息安全·云计算·yum源·系统运维·openclaw
haibindev2 天前
在 Windows+WSL2 上部署 OpenClaw AI员工的实践与踩坑
linux·wsl2·openclaw
NineData2 天前
数据库管理工具NineData,一年进化成为数万+开发者的首选数据库工具?
运维·数据结构·数据库
程序员小崔日记2 天前
一篇文章彻底搞懂 MySQL 和 Redis:原理、区别、项目用法全解析(建议收藏)
redis·mysql·项目实战